When shopping for the best collapsible wagon, the frame, fabric, and weight capacity grab most of the attention. However, the most critical feature for performance often goes overlooked: the wheels.
The type, size, and material of your wagon’s wheels dictate where you can easily roll it. Choosing the wrong type can turn a convenient hauling trip into a frustrating drag.
This guide breaks down the most common collapsible wagon wheel types, detailing the pros and cons to help you select the ideal rolling partner for your adventures, whether you’re heading to the beach, garden, or grocery store.

Regardless of the material, remember the golden rule of wagon wheels:
Larger Diameter + Wider Tread = Better Off-Road Performance
If you anticipate frequent use on soft surfaces like sand or thick grass, prioritize wide-set wheels (typically 4 inches or wider) with a large diameter (7 inches or more) to distribute the weight and maintain momentum.
